Towards Cardiac Output Estimation Using Earbud Photoplethysmography Sensor

Abstract#
Cardiac Output (CO) monitoring is vital for tracking cardiovascular health. In medical settings, cardiac output is monitored invasively, posing physical limitations and making it difficult to monitor CO continuously. In contrast, we leveraged an earbud PPG to non-invasively and continuously monitor CO. Among 11 selected subjects for model development, we observed an MAE of 1.53 L/min and an MAPE of 18.82%. By considering signal quality and PPG morphology, we can improve CO prediction. Our results present an opportunity to lower the barrier for noninvasive PPG-based CO monitoring.
